Palin is Back – Biden Makes Up “Facts” in VP debate

Over the past few weeks there have been a few interviews, most notably with Katie Couric, where Governor Palin seemed uncomfortable, over rehearsed, over coached and simply not the governor we were all introduced to in her Vice Presidential speech in St. Paul 5 weeks ago. There were many McCain supporters who were quietly, or in come cases forcefully, questioning her pick.

In the Vice Presidential debate, the old Sarah Palin that America originally fell in love with returned.

She began by seeming a bit nervous and initially gave a few obviously rehearsed answers, but as the debate wore on she began to gain confidence, stopped giving rehearsed answers, spoke directly to Joe Biden and the American people.

There was also a change in Biden’s demeanor as the debate progressed. He began smirking more, nervously laughing, and getting more agitated. Biden did an admirable job in explaining his issues and those of Obama’s, however he consistently mischaracterized his ticket’s positions and John McCain’s votes. In some cases he flat out lied:

- Biden said Obama would not meet with Ahmadinejad without preconditions. Everyone knows Obama said this publically: video

-95% of people will get a tax break when 40% already don’t pay taxes!

-When Palin questioned Obama’s judgment when he voted to increase taxes on anyone making over 42k a year Biden said McCain voted the same way. Definitely not true.

-He said McCain also voted against funding the troops when in fact he voted against a time line.

-Biden said he is not against clean coal when there is video all over the internet of him saying that he is against it.

-Biden said McCain was against reforms on Freddie and Fannie when in fact it was McCain who proposed a senate bill asking for reforms.

-Biden said that McCain is against alternate energy when McCain had consistently advocated an “all of the above” strategy to gaining energy independence.

-This is just a few of many

Many of the political pundits after the debate were saying that Palin did an admirable job but Biden won because he beat her on the facts! There were headlines like “Biden wins on substance” or “Biden out debates Palin with facts.” If these people believe that Biden’s biggest strength in the debate was his recitation of the facts then clearly he had a very bad night. His entire performance was full of lies and mischaracterizations. The unfortunate aspect of this debate is that many voters will take what Biden said as truth and that his confident delivery showed his command of the issues.

The good news is that Palin was strong, patriotic, and came across as much less political than Joe Biden. It was nice to see the original Sarah Palin return to this campaign. Hopefully the facts will continue to come out about Obama and Biden’s record so that the American voters will know the true political positions of these men.
